Restricted Access

There have been serious problems here in the past but access appears less problematic providing climbers keep a low profile. The quarries are owned by Gwynedd Council who make it clear that there is no offical access due to public safety reasons - there are high fences and signs prohibiting access, but there have not been any reports of practical access problems for many years.

In early 2017 planning permisson was granted for a new hydro-electric power station on the site. When works starts on this (unkknow time-scale) its likley that access to some of the quarries will be permenently lost, especially to Mancer and Film Set Quarries as these will become flooded to produce a holding reservoir.  

Seasonal Restrictions

Dates: 1 March to 30 June

Reason: Nesting Birds

- Due to nesting Peregrines and Choughs (both species have legal protection under the Wildlife & Countryside Act),  some climbing in the Gideon Quarry (all routes on Gideon Terrace and Cracking up areas) is restricted from March 1st until the end of June.

 

26m. The line of 12 bolts to the R of Damocles. Reached from below via a short 5m scramble up a slate staircase to a slate patio, bolt anchor, in situ rope & comfy chair!
Follow the crack past a tricky overlap but then more easily, to its end. Continue up the groove above until it peters out, then step L & up to the lower-off bolts.

Frazer Ball & Neil Harrison 15/Dec/2023.
